Signs and Wonders: Getting to the Heart of Jesus’ Miracles

In 2006, National Geographic News reported that US and Israeli scientists had come up with a theory that Jesus might have walked on ice rather than on water. Their findings were based on evidence of two periods of climatic cooling in the region 2,000 to 2,600 years ago. The article said the discovery could provide a scientific explanation for what many people have regarded as supernatural.
What are miracles and why do people struggle or even refuse to accept the miracles of Jesus? What’s at stake? Our Daily Bread Ministries research editor Dennis Fisher takes a look not only at the miracles of Jesus but at their implications as well.
